You'll require a few tools to change the batteries in the Honda key fob. The easiest way to open the key fob is to locate the button that releases the key made of metal inside. Press and hold the button for several seconds, then pull out the key. Once the key is out you will be able to see two plastic pieces with a space for the key in the middle of them. Wedge the top of your key into this space, then apply gentle pressure. This will cause the fob's back to pop open. A screw will be revealed that holds the two parts together.
Take the screw off using an screwdriver with a flat head and then divide the fob's halves. If you have trouble using pliers, you can use a pair. Look for a sticker on the fob that indicates what kind of batteries it requires. You may also be able to see the specifications of the battery on the back of the fob.
When the battery dies it will stop working when you're not expecting it. It could happen while driving along the road or while trying to open your trunk. Certain models will flash a warning signal when the battery is near expiring.
Replace the battery
Honda keys for cars come with a variety of features that make life easier, safer, and more convenient. These include remote lock and unlock remotes, panic button, remote start, etc. However these features won't function as well if battery in the key fob is low or dead. Replacing the battery of your honda civic car key replacement cost key fob is a simple procedure that can restore all functions.
The first thing you need to determine is the type of battery in your Honda key fob. Examine the label on the back of the key fob to determine what kind of battery it is. If there's no label, you can remove the battery using a flathead screwdriver. Be sure to take care to do this in a safe manner so that the internal buttons and circuit board don't fall out.
Insert the new battery into the key fob by using the (+) and (+) markings to guide you. Be cautious not to touch the terminals with your fingers because the oils that are absorbed by your skin can cause corrosion and decrease the battery's lifespan. After the battery is in place, you can align the two parts of the key fob, then press hard to secure it.
The key fob also includes an emergency blade that can be used in the event of the key is broken or lost. The key blade is placed into the keyhole on your car's door or ignition to open it or start the engine.
The Honda key fob comes with advanced security measures, like rolling codes. These unique codes are updated each time the key fob is used to connect with the onboard systems of your car which makes it extremely difficult to hack or alter the signal.
